Kiddieland in Melrose Park
I want to take my niece to Kiddieland ( Kiddieland Amusement Park - Melrose Park Illinois) this weekend to see Dora The Explorer. I know it's just some guy in a costume, but just like any other 3 year old, she's crazy about Dora. Anyway, a few people (who, by the way have never been there) told me that the area it's in is ghetto and the park itself is a complete craphole. I tried looking up reviews on the internet, but the most recent one is from 2007.
Has anyone been there recently and can share their experience? I don't want to take her someplace where I won't feel she's safe. Thanks!
